RFGPH3−RESET

d

1071/5 bin

1400/4 2

HIGH: Sets RFGPH3−OUT = 0 (jump)
LOW: RFGPH3−PHOUT is set according to the input values RFGPH3−SET and
RFGPH3−ACT
The input has priority over all other inputs.

RFGPH3−STOP

d

1071/6 bin

1070/5 2

HIGH: Output RFGPH3−NOUT is decelerated to 0 rpm along the ramp
C1079/1, output RFGPH3−PHOUT remains the same.
LOW: RFGPH3−PHOUT is set according to the input values RFGPH3−SET and
RFGPH3−ACT.
The input has priority over RFGPH3−RFG−0

RFGPH3−RFG−0

d

1071/7 bin

1070/6 2

HIGH: Traverses according to the ramp selected for RFGPH3−ACT = 0
LOW: RFGPH3−OUT is set according to the input values RFGPH3−SET and
RFGPH3−ACT.

RFGPH3−REL−SEL d

1071/8 bin

1070/8 2

HIGH: Relative positioning
LOW: Absolute positioning

RFGPH3−SET

ph

1073/3 dec [inc]

1072/3 3

Position setpoint (65536 inc. = 1 rev.)

RFGPH3−ACT

ph

1073/4 dec [inc]

1072/4 3

Position setpoint (65536 inc = 1 rev.)

RFGPH3−RFG−I=0 d

HIGH: RFGPH3−SET = RFGPH3−ACT

RFGPH3−PHOUT

ph

Output (65536 inc = 1 rev.)

RFGPH3−NOUT

phd

Output RFGPH3−PHOUT as speed
